Photo AI

4.1 Watter EEN van die volgende is 'n voorbeeld van 'n DBBD ('DBMS')? Oracle MS Excel FireFox Delphi 4.2 Noem TWEE aspekte van databasisontwerp wat in ag geneem moet word om doeltreffende funksionaliteit te verseker - NSC Information Technology - Question 4 - 2017 - Paper 2

Question icon

Question 4

4.1-Watter-EEN-van-die-volgende-is-'n-voorbeeld-van-'n-DBBD-('DBMS')?---Oracle---MS-Excel---FireFox---Delphi-----4.2-Noem-TWEE-aspekte-van-databasisontwerp-wat-in-ag-geneem-moet-word-om-doeltreffende-funksionaliteit-te-verseker-NSC Information Technology-Question 4-2017-Paper 2.png

4.1 Watter EEN van die volgende is 'n voorbeeld van 'n DBBD ('DBMS')? Oracle MS Excel FireFox Delphi 4.2 Noem TWEE aspekte van databasisontwerp wat in ag... show full transcript

Worked Solution & Example Answer:4.1 Watter EEN van die volgende is 'n voorbeeld van 'n DBBD ('DBMS')? Oracle MS Excel FireFox Delphi 4.2 Noem TWEE aspekte van databasisontwerp wat in ag geneem moet word om doeltreffende funksionaliteit te verseker - NSC Information Technology - Question 4 - 2017 - Paper 2

Step 1

Wat is 'n voorbeeld van 'n DBBD ('DBMS')?

96%

114 rated

Answer

Die voorbeeld van 'n databasisbestuurstelsel (DBMS) wat relevant is, is Oracle. DBMS's مانند Oracle is ontwerp om die stoor, doelgerigte toegang en administrasie van databasisdata te vergemaklik.

Step 2

Noem TWEE aspekte van databasisontwerp wat in ag geneem moet word om doeltreffende funksionaliteit te verseker.

99%

104 rated

Answer

Twee belangrike aspekte van databasisontwerp sluit in:

  1. Data integriteit - wat verseker dat die data akkuraat en konsekwent is.
  2. Data beveiliging - wat beteken dat toegang tot die data beveilig moet wees om onbevoegde toegang te voorkom.

Step 3

Beskryf wat 'n rekord in 'n databasis is.

96%

101 rated

Answer

'n Rekord in 'n databasis is 'n versameling van veld(s) of data/gegevens wat op 'n spesifieke entiteit verwys. Elke rekord bevat inligting oor 'n unieke entiteit in die databasis.

Step 4

Verdeellik wat die begin- en einddatum is.

98%

120 rated

Answer

Die 'BeginDatum' en 'EindDatum' dui op die tydperk waarop 'n toer plaasvind. 'BeginDatum' verwys na die startdatum van die toer, terwyl 'EindDatum' die datum aandui waarop die toer eindig. Hierdie datums moet stored word in 'n DateTime datatipe vir akkurate tydsberekening.

Step 5

Verduidelik wat 'n opdateringsonreëlmatigheid ('update anomaly') is, deur die toergids Kajal Singh as 'n voorbeeld te gebruik.

97%

117 rated

Answer

'n Opdateringsonreëlmatigheid ontstaan wanneer die inligting oor 'n enkele entiteit op verskeie plekke in die databasis stoor word. Byvoorbeeld, indien die telefoonnommer van die toergids Kajal Singh verander, dan moet dit in al die rekords waar Kajal Singh as 'n toergids verskyn, opgedateer word. Dit kan lei tot inkonsekwentheid indien een of meer rekords nie opgedateer word nie.

Step 6

Verdeel die tabel in meer as een tabel.

97%

121 rated

Answer

Om die tabel in meer as een te verdeel, kan ons die inligting oor toere en toergidse skei deur 'n aparte tabel vir toergidse te skep. Elke tabel moet 'n primêre sleutel hê, soos 'n unieke ID, en daar moet 'n een-toe-baie verwantskap tussen die twee tafels wees.

Step 7

Wat is die resultaat nadat hierdie stelling uitgevoer is?

96%

114 rated

Answer

Die SQL-stelling 'DELETE FROM tblToere' sal al die rekords in die tblToere-tabel verwyder. Dit sal lei tot 'n leë tabel, wat beteken dat daar geen inligting oor toere in die databasis sal wees nie.

Step 8

Verduidelik kortliks hoe gebruik van parallelle datastelle die verlies van data kan voorkom.

99%

104 rated

Answer

Parallelle datastelle bied redundans en koperbundeling aan. Indien een stel data beskadig word of verlore gaan, is die ander stel steeds beskikbaar, wat die kans op data verlies verminder.

Step 9

Verduidelik hoe SQL-ontginning ('SQL injection') in verhoed kan word.

96%

101 rated

Answer

SQL-ontginning kan voorkom word deur die gebruik van voorbereide uitsprake of parameterised queries, wat die invoer van gebruikers sanitiseer en verifieer voordat dit in 'n SQL-uitspraak ingesluit word. Dit verminder die risiko dat kwaadwillige insette die databasis kan beïnvloed.

Join the NSC students using SimpleStudy...

97% of Students

Report Improved Results

98% of Students

Recommend to friends

100,000+

Students Supported

1 Million+

Questions answered

;